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Pen-y-Bont (Mid Wales) to Foxton start from as little as £32.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Pen-y-Bont (Mid Wales) to Foxton start from £111.90 one way, or £112.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Pen-y-Bont (Mid Wales) to Foxton are available for £159.50 one way, or £319.00 return

Facilities and Amenities

Travelers visiting Pen-y-Bont (Mid Wales) train station will notice that it operates on a minimalistic scale. Unfortunately, there is no ticket office or ticket machine present here, and tickets purchased online cannot be collected at the station either. The good news is that there's an induction loop available, which supports passengers with hearing impairments. Although the station doesn’t house waiting rooms, there's some seating provided, perfect for those awaiting their train in the open air. For accessibility, the station does offer step-free access, though it involves crossing the tracks via an uncontrolled foot crossing.

Onward Travel Options

When it comes to onward journeys from Pen-y-Bont, options are somewhat limited. There’s a rail replacement bus stop located conveniently on the corner of the station approach road and the A44, which can come in handy during service disruptions. Currently, there are no facilities for bicycle storage or hire, so it's crucial for cyclists to plan their travels accordingly.

Essential Facilities and Services

Foxton Train Station ensures your ticketing experience is hassle-free with its user-friendly ticket machines. While there isn't a ticket office, you can easily collect your pre-purchased tickets from these machines. They're designed to accommodate all passengers, including those using the Disabled Persons Railcard.

As part of its commitment to accessibility, the station offers step-free access to both platforms via short ramps and a level crossing, ensuring ease of use for all travelers. Assistance is readily available through the help points located on platforms, and with CCTV monitoring, you're assured of a safe environment at all times.
